The Characteristics of Clay Soil and Its Impact on Fence Posts

Clay soil is distinctive due to its fine particles and compact structure. In Adams, TN, this often means a heavy, sticky soil that becomes almost impermeable when wet and rock-hard when dry. This composition has several implications for fence post stability. Firstly, clay’s poor drainage capabilities mean that water can accumulate around the base of posts, leading to prolonged saturation. This constant moisture can weaken the surrounding soil, making it less supportive over time. Furthermore, the freeze-thaw cycles common in Tennessee winters can be particularly destructive in clay-rich environments. As water in the soil freezes, it expands, pushing against the fence posts—a phenomenon known as frost heave.

When the ice thaws, the soil contracts, leaving voids that can cause posts to settle unevenly. Repeated cycles of expansion and contraction can gradually lift and shift posts out of alignment, compromising the entire fence line. Beyond frost heave, the expansive nature of clay soil itself can be problematic. When clay dries out, it shrinks, creating cracks and gaps. When it gets wet again, it expands, exerting significant lateral pressure on fence posts. Without proper installation techniques tailored to these conditions, an aluminum fence post in Adams’ clay soil may not maintain its intended vertical alignment or structural integrity for as long as desired.

Traditional Post Anchoring vs. Clay Soil Realities

When it comes to fence post anchoring, many traditional methods often fall short in challenging soil conditions like the clay found in Adams, TN. The most common approach involves digging a hole, setting the post, and backfilling with concrete. While effective in well-draining, stable soils, this method can encounter issues in clay. The concrete footing, if not designed correctly, can act like a cup, trapping water around the post, exacerbating the problems of poor drainage and frost heave. The expansive and contractile forces of clay can also put immense stress on the concrete collar, potentially leading to cracking or separation from the post over time.

For homeowners in Adams, simply pouring concrete around an aluminum post might not be sufficient to guarantee long-term stability. The interface between the concrete and the surrounding clay soil becomes a critical point of vulnerability. Without proper drainage strategies or a wider, bell-shaped footing, the concrete can be pushed up by frost or shifted by expanding clay, taking the fence post with it. Mitigating Frost Heave and Enhancing Drainage for Fence Stability

Effectively mitigating frost heave and enhancing drainage are paramount for ensuring the long-term stability of aluminum fence posts in Adams, TN’s clay-rich soil. Frost heave, as previously discussed, occurs when moisture in the soil freezes and expands, pushing posts upward. To combat this, installers must ensure that the fence post footings extend below the frost line, which is the maximum depth to which soil freezes in a given region. In Tennessee, this depth can vary, but generally going deeper provides better protection. A wider footing at the base of the post, often bell-shaped, can also help resist upward movement by creating a larger surface area for the soil to grip, making it harder for frost to lift the post.

Drainage is another critical factor. Because clay soil retains water, measures must be taken to prevent water from pooling around the post base. Incorporating a layer of gravel or crushed stone at the bottom of the post hole before setting the post can provide a drainage bed, allowing water to dissipate more effectively. This helps prevent the soil from becoming overly saturated and reduces the likelihood of frost heave and the softening of the surrounding clay. Advanced Techniques for Aluminum Fence Post Installation in Clay Soil

Given the specific challenges presented by Adams, TN’s clay-rich soil, advanced installation techniques are often necessary to ensure optimal aluminum fence post stability. Beyond simply digging deeper, specialized methods focus on creating a more stable and resilient foundation. One effective technique involves creating a ‘gravel collar’ around the concrete footing. After the post is set in concrete, the remaining space in the hole is filled with gravel rather than compacted clay. This gravel layer acts as a capillary break, preventing moisture from wicking up to the concrete and post, and also allows for better drainage, reducing the impact of frost heave and soil expansion.

Another approach considers the use of dry concrete mix directly into the hole, then saturating it with water. This can sometimes lead to a more compact and stronger bond, though careful moisture control is essential. For particularly problematic areas, some professionals might even consider helical piers or other specialized anchoring systems that bypass the superficial clay layers and anchor into more stable soil strata below. Maintaining Your Aluminum Fence in Adams’ Varying Climate

Beyond the initial installation, proper maintenance is crucial for preserving the integrity and appearance of your aluminum fence in Adams, TN, especially given the region’s climate. While aluminum fences are known for being low maintenance, a few simple practices can extend their lifespan and ensure they continue to look great. Regularly cleaning your fence with mild soap and water can remove dirt, pollen, and other environmental residues that might accumulate, especially after heavy rains common in Tennessee. This prevents buildup that could potentially stain the finish over time. Inspecting your fence periodically for any signs of wear, loose fasteners, or minor damage is also a good habit.

Pay particular attention to the base of the posts, especially after significant weather events like heavy rainfall or freezing temperatures. Look for any signs of shifting, leaning, or soil erosion around the footings. Addressing minor issues promptly, such as tightening a loose gate hinge or clearing debris from around posts, can prevent them from escalating into more significant and costly problems.
